Output 6af357df1c33f79bdb1972641e5583ec149498ad2eda13c0d42d6b60cf728e3e:0

value
584761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 535f8fc6497b6cf65198c22ffe4d1aa9c954912a OP_EQUAL
address
39HrVCkUScqkM16FQaxgJ3A1TjfqNzLz9A
transaction
6af357df1c33f79bdb1972641e5583ec149498ad2eda13c0d42d6b60cf728e3e
confirmations
161325
spent
true